Product Overview

Category

The FQB10N60CTM belongs to the category of power MOSFETs.

Use

It is commonly used in power supply applications, motor control, and other high-power switching applications.

Characteristics

  • High voltage capability
  • Low on-resistance
  • Fast switching speed
  • Low gate charge
  • Avalanche energy specified

Package

The FQB10N60CTM is typically available in a TO-263 package.

Essence

This MOSFET is essential for efficient power management and control in various electronic systems.

Packaging/Quantity

It is usually packaged in reels with quantities varying based on customer requirements.

Specifications

  • Drain-Source Voltage (VDS): 600V
  • Continuous Drain Current (ID): 10A
  • On-Resistance (RDS(on)): 0.52Ω
  • Gate-Source Voltage (VGS): ±20V
  • Total Gate Charge (Qg): 18nC
  • Avalanche Energy (EAS): 160mJ

Detailed Pin Configuration

The FQB10N60CTM typically has three pins: 1. Gate (G) 2. Drain (D) 3. Source (S)

Functional Features

  • High voltage capability allows for use in various power applications.
  • Low on-resistance minimizes power loss and improves efficiency.
  • Fast switching speed enables rapid control in switching applications.

Advantages

  • High voltage capability suitable for diverse applications
  • Low on-resistance for reduced power dissipation
  • Fast switching speed for efficient control

Disadvantages

  • Higher gate capacitance compared to some alternative models
  • Limited current handling capacity compared to higher-rated devices

Working Principles

The FQB10N60CTM operates based on the principles of field-effect transistors, utilizing its gate-source voltage to control the flow of current between the drain and source terminals.
